What does EVO ICL?
EVO ICL, or the Evo Implantable Collamer Lens, is a innovative eye surgery designed for patients seeking visual correction without the need for conventional glasses or contact lenses. The EVO ICL is a type of implantable contact lens that is inserted inside the eye, specifically between the colored part of the eye and the lens of the eye. This procedure aims to fix refractive errors such as nearsightedness, farsightedness, and irregular vision, making it a widely applicable option for a variety of patients.
Unlike laser-based procedures like laser-assisted in situ keratomileusis, which reshape the cornea, EVO ICL maintains the integrity of the eye's structure. It offers a unique alternative for patients with compromised corneas or those who may not be suitable for laser surgery. Evo Implantable Collamer Lens vs Alternative Vision Correction Techniques
When considering options for vision correction, patients often weigh the benefits and drawbacks of various procedures. The Evo Implantable Collamer Lens, or the Evo Implantable Collamer Lens, stands out as a preferred choice for many, especially among those with high myopia or thin corneas. In contrast to LASIK, which permanently reshapes the cornea, EVO ICL offers a reversible solution that does not alter the corneal structure. This feature makes it appealing for individuals who may experience changes in their vision as they age, as the ICL can be removed or replaced when needed.
Another important comparison is with PRK (Photorefractive Keratectomy). While both EVO ICL and PRK strive to correct refractive errors, their approaches differ significantly. PRK works on the surface of the cornea, which can lead to a longer recovery time and discomfort following the procedure. In contrast, the EVO ICL procedure typically has a quicker recovery and minimal downtime, allowing patients to return to normal activities almost immediately. However, the choice between these methods depends on individual eye health, lifestyle, and preferences.
Ultimately, it is worth noting the advancements in other technologies, such as SMILE (Small Incision Lenticule Extraction). While SMILE is a less invasive form of laser eye surgery, it is primarily suitable for myopia and astigmatism corrections. EVO ICL, on the other hand, can address a wider range of refractive errors and is particularly effective for patients who have not responded well to other procedures, making it a versatile option for those seeking permanent vision correction.
EVO ICL Procedure and Recovery
The Implantable Collamer Lens procedure begins with a detailed eye examination to assess if you are a proper candidate for the implantable collamer lens. Once found suitable, the surgery is typically performed in an outpatient setting, enabling you to go back home the same afternoon. During the procedure, anesthetic eye drops are applied to reduce discomfort. The doctor makes a tiny incision in the eye surface and precisely inserts the EVO ICL behind the iris, where it works to address myopia, irregular vision, or various vision issues.
As for post-operative recovery, many individuals experience enhanced sight almost immediately after the surgery. The initial post-operative period usually involves minimal discomfort, with some swelling and light sensitivity being typical. Patients are often advised to avoid heavy exercise for a brief time and to follow any specific instructions given by their surgeon. Regular follow-up appointments are crucial to check recovery and ensure optimal visual results.
